Theory of Constructiveness of Human Being:Reconstruction of the Theoretical Foundation of"Person-in-Environment"of Social Work Practice(middle part)
Though social work theories are from social sciences,they are not for mechanically applying social theories but for illustrating the validity of practice. Social work theories are theories of elucidating the reasons of interventional practice processes,rather than theories of general rule and law of social phenomenon. This series of essays includes up,middle and down three articles,which systematically review the classification models and construction ways of Western social work theories,construct a new theoretical foundation of"Person-in-Environment"of social work practice based on sorting out the viewpoints about human being,development and practice from social sciences. It suggests that we could substitute ecosystem theories as the foundation of generalist social work with the life history theory and reflective practice theory. The second article,in a series of essays that reconstruct the theoretical foundation of the practice framework of the"Person-in-Environment"of social work,mainly discusses the concept of human beings as the core factor of the"Person-in-Environment"of social work practice. After the enlightenment,reasonable person had become the precondition of western philosophy and social science. It seems very simple that if you will like to become a reasonable person,you just turn back to reflect and you would be a reasonable person. Meanwhile,along with the emergence of psychoanalysis,behaviorism and humanism of three approaches of psychological theory,modern psychology had broken the myth of just turning back to reflect will become a reasonable person. But,no matter whether psychoanalysis or behaviorism,they employ some science or rationality to analyze the non-rational mechanisms of the mind or explain the mechanical behavior model,but they do not illustrate where the science or rationality comes from. It is just humanism that assumes self-growth as the potential of human beings and proposes to build humane relationships to facilitate the growth of human beings. This theory solves the puzzle of origins of rationality. Nevertheless,humanism lacks an explanation of the self-growth of human beings through humane relationships;phenomenology could help explain this question. Edmund Husserl try to rely on suspending strategy to enter into pure conscious,so as to explain genetic of mind of human being. Alfred Schultz go backward from Husserl,he enters into the social relations to explain the subjectivity of human being. Schultz differentiates social relations as different kinds,such as"we"relations,other world relations,Schultz argues that the more remote or anonymous relations,the more abstract or stereotypical understanding of the subject. This will result in misunderstanding about relations of subject. For this reason,we need enter into existentialism to understand the being in the world and the existent world. Only by bringing traditions to the present,people could,according to the need of practice,critically interpret and dialogue with each other,and arrive at a fusing of horizonsMeanwhile,in reality,it is not truth that every person would like to critically interpret with each other to arrive at mutual understanding. It may be just another side of the world that people identify some kind of cultural category to construct some collective identity,and cross it with class identity to make crossing identity politics. This will further dissolve the foundation of mutual understanding. Therefore,social work could not cure a client based on the assumption of rationality and instrumental technology,nor assume good traits of human to trust the client to become better automatically. Social work should start form the point of constructiveness of human being,tries to change differentiated identity politics,and construct mutual concern and understanding relations based on legitimacy of the situation.
